The School of Public Affairs and Administration also offers a minor option for the law and society program. The minor requires 18 hours of coursework. This includes nine hours of core courses and nine hours of electives, either from Law and Society courses, or relevant interdisciplinary courses.

Minor Hours & Minor GPA
While completing all required courses, students obtaining a minor in law and society must also meet each of the following hour and GPA minimum standards:
-
Minor Hours
Satisfied by 18 hours of minor courses
-
Minor Hours in Residence
Satisfied by a minimum of 9 hours of KU resident credit in the minor
-
Minor Junior/Senior Hours
Satisfied by a minimum of 18 hours from junior/senior courses (300-level and above) in the minor
-
Minor Junior/Senior Graduation GPA
Satisfied by a minimum of a 2.0 KU GPA in all departmental courses (300-level and above) in the minor. GPA calculations include all junior/senior courses in the field of study including Fs and repeated courses. See the Semester/Cumulative GPA Calculator.
